EDF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2024 in Review

35 of the 6,958 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Virtus Stone Harbor Emerging Markets Income Fund (EDF) for Q1 2024, worth a combined $13.7M — up 11% from $12.4M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 11 funds closed out of EDF and 5 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 10 trimmed existing stakes and 12 added.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$967K. The largest seller was Wolverine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.28M sold.
